upgrade to 1.6 causes boot images to disappear
Bug #1338690 reported by
Blake Rouse
This bug affects 2 people
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
MAAS |
Fix Released
|
Critical
|
Blake Rouse |
Bug Description
When upgrading for 1.5 to 1.6, the boot images on the cluster will be reported as zero.
This is because of the new level in the boot-resources directory. Previously it was arch/subarch/
Related branches
lp://qastaging/~blake-rouse/maas/cluster-upgrade-boot-resources
- Gavin Panella (community): Approve
-
Diff: 210 lines (+159/-1)2 files modifiedsrc/provisioningserver/tests/test_upgrade_cluster.py (+97/-0)
src/provisioningserver/upgrade_cluster.py (+62/-1)
lp://qastaging/~blake-rouse/maas/boot-image-xinstall-migration
- Gavin Panella (community): Approve
-
Diff: 24 lines (+8/-1)1 file modifiedsrc/maasserver/migrations/0086_add_xinstall_path_and_type_to_bootimage.py (+8/-1)
lp://qastaging/~blake-rouse/maas/append-current-dir-for-boot-images-migration
- Raphaël Badin (community): Approve
- Gavin Panella (community): Approve
-
Diff: 248 lines (+80/-26)4 files modifiedsrc/provisioningserver/boot/tests/test_tftppath.py (+19/-0)
src/provisioningserver/boot/tftppath.py (+5/-2)
src/provisioningserver/tests/test_upgrade_cluster.py (+47/-15)
src/provisioningserver/upgrade_cluster.py (+9/-9)
Changed in maas: | |
status: | In Progress → Fix Committed |
tags: | added: needs-qa |
Changed in maas: | |
status: | In Progress → Fix Committed |
tags: |
added: qa-ok removed: qa-bad |
Changed in maas: | |
status: | Fix Committed → Fix Released |
To post a comment you must log in.
I tested the fix and it doesn't work, see my report on the branch's MP: https:/ /code.launchpad .net/~blake- rouse/maas/ cluster- upgrade- boot-resources/ +merge/ 225868/ comments/ 544812